Preparing your home for a smooth move

Prepared boxes and furniture for a local Tufnell Park move

Good preparation can make a major difference to how quickly and smoothly your move goes. Even when you have hired experienced house removalists, there are still helpful things you can do before moving day to reduce delays and protect your belongings. A little organisation beforehand can also make unpacking much easier once you arrive at your new property.

It is useful to sort out what will be moved, what will be donated or discarded, and what you want to keep close at hand. Important documents, medication, valuables, and everyday essentials should usually stay separate so they are easy to access. If you are moving with children or pets, planning ahead can also reduce stress on the day by keeping routines as normal as possible.

Remember that every property move is different. A one-bedroom flat in Tufnell Park will not need the same preparation as a large multi-storey house, and a short local move will not require the same level of packing as a long-distance relocation. The more clearly your items are organised, the easier it is for the removals team to work efficiently and for you to settle into the new place.

Preparation checklist

  • Label boxes by room and content type
  • Separate essentials for the first 24 hours
  • Defrost fridges and freezers if required
  • Disassemble only if you are sure it is safe to do so
  • Keep valuables, passports, and important paperwork with you
  • Reserve lifts or notify building managers where needed
  • Measure larger furniture for tight entrances and stairways

What affects the cost of a house move

People often want to know what influences the price of a home removal service. While exact costs depend on the details of the job, several common factors usually affect the overall quote. Understanding these factors can help you compare services fairly and avoid surprises later on. A reliable quote should reflect the actual work involved.

The main things that usually matter are the size of the property, the volume of belongings, access conditions, distance between addresses, and whether any extra services are needed. Packing help, dismantling and reassembly, special handling for fragile or heavy items, and waiting time can all affect how the move is planned. In areas like Tufnell Park, parking and access can also be important, especially if the vehicle cannot be parked directly outside.

If you are moving from a flat with several flights of stairs, or if furniture needs to be carried a long way from the vehicle, the job may take longer than a simple ground-floor move. The best way to get an accurate quote is to provide honest details about your property, the items to be moved, and any access concerns. This helps the removal team recommend the right level of support.

Pricing factors to consider

  • Property size and number of rooms
  • Total volume and weight of items
  • Distance between pickup and delivery addresses
  • Stairs, lifts, and access restrictions
  • Parking limitations or long carry distances
  • Packing, dismantling, and assembly requirements
  • Timing needs, such as weekend or short-notice moves

Frequently asked questions

How far in advance should I book house removalists in Tufnell Park?

It is sensible to book as early as possible, especially if you are moving at a busy time of year, at a weekend, or around the end of the month. Early booking helps secure your preferred date and gives you more time to prepare.

Can you help with flats and houses?

Yes. Many local removals jobs involve a mix of property types, from converted flats and maisonettes to larger terraced houses. The service can be adapted to suit stairs, shared access, and other layout considerations.

Do I need to pack everything myself?

Not necessarily. Some customers prefer to pack independently, while others want help with selected items or the full move. Packing assistance can be useful for fragile goods, busy households, or anyone who wants to save time.

What if parking is difficult outside my home?

Parking challenges are common in Tufnell Park and nearby streets. A local removals team should take this into account when planning the move and can advise on how best to manage loading access and timing.

Can you move bulky or awkward furniture?

Yes, many house moves include sofas, wardrobes, beds, dining tables, appliances, and other difficult items. It is helpful to mention anything unusually heavy, large, or fragile when you request a quote so the team can prepare properly.

Do you handle short-distance moves within the area?

Absolutely. Many customers move just a short distance, whether within Tufnell Park or to nearby areas such as Archway, Kentish Town, Gospel Oak, Highgate, or Holloway. Local moves still benefit from professional planning and careful handling.
